Hi David,

I recommend to test your REST commands with curl before building into your C+ 
program. See http://docs.geoserver.org/stable/en/user/rest/examples/curl.html

For creating a coverageStore you have to send the raster data directly. You 
don't have to send any xml code.

Here is an example for creating a geotiff coveragestore with curl:
curl -v -u <user>:<password> -XPUT -H "Content-type:application/zip" 
--data-binary @<local path to zipped raster data> http://<geoserver 
ip>/geoserver/rest/workspaces/<workspace name>/coveragestores/<coveragestore 
name>/file.geotiff

You have to send the data as zip file and use -XPUT if you send it to a remote 
server. 

IF your data is already located on the server where geoserver is running you 
can use (curl example):
curl -v -u <user>:<password> -XPOST -H "Content-type:text/plain"
 -d "file:///<local path to zipped raster data>" 
http://<geoserver ip>/geoserver/rest/workspaces/<workspace 
name>/coveragestores/<coveragestore name>/external.geotiff

See also http://docs.geoserver.org/stable/en/user/rest/api/coveragestores.html

> Hi list,
> 
> I'm trying to add a coverage store through REST API but I'm not sure if it's 
> possible or if I'm doing it the right way. Here's my scenario:
> 
> I've got several ECW raster files that I want to automatically be 
> populated using the REST API. So far I've achieved to populate a 
> workspace, buy when it comes to add a CoverageStore I get a 405 Method 
> not permitted response. I'm sending the requests from a C# program 
> using normal WebRequests. I've configured DIGEST Auth following 
> http://docs.geoserver.org/latest/en/user/security/tutorials/digest/ind
> ex.html
> 
> Now, here's the data I'm sending:
> 
> <coverageStore><name>PRUEBA</name><workspace>new_workspace_csharp_2</w
> orkspace><enabled>true</enabled><source>file://\\192.168.1.15\\IMAGENE
> S_SATELITE\\SENTINEL2\\S2A_OPER_MSI_L1C_DS_EPA_20150821T111616945Z_IrR
> G.ecw</source><format>ECW</format></coverageStore>
> 
> I've tried sending the method as PUT and POST but without success in both 
> cases.
> 
> So my questions are:
> 
> Is it possible to add a Covergae Store from the REST API?
> 
> Is ECW format supported for REST API - Coverage Store?
> 
> When sending the request, the url should be something like 
> http://mygeoserver.com/rest/TELEDETEKZIOA/coveragestores/S2A_OPER_MSI_L1C_DS_EPA_20150821T111616945Z_IrRG.ecw
>   ???
> 
> Any ideas why I'm getting a 405 response?
